首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

实体类型变量的symfony断言

实体类型变量的Symfony断言是Symfony框架中用于验证实体类型变量的工具。Symfony断言是一种用于在开发过程中进行断言和验证的工具,它可以帮助开发人员确保代码的正确性和稳定性。

具体来说,实体类型变量的Symfony断言可以用于验证一个变量是否是一个实体类型。在Symfony框架中,实体类型通常指的是与数据库表对应的对象,也称为实体对象。通过使用Symfony断言,开发人员可以在代码中对实体类型变量进行验证,以确保其符合预期的类型。

Symfony断言提供了多种方法来验证实体类型变量,例如:

  1. assertInstanceOf(): 用于验证一个变量是否是指定的类的实例。
  2. assertInternalType(): 用于验证一个变量是否是指定的内部类型,如字符串、整数等。
  3. assertCount(): 用于验证一个变量是否包含指定数量的元素,适用于数组或可迭代对象。
  4. assertEmpty(): 用于验证一个变量是否为空,适用于字符串、数组、集合等。
  5. assertNotEmpty(): 用于验证一个变量是否不为空。
  6. assertSame(): 用于验证两个变量是否引用同一个对象。
  7. assertNotSame(): 用于验证两个变量是否引用不同的对象。

通过使用这些Symfony断言方法,开发人员可以对实体类型变量进行全面的验证,确保其类型正确,并且符合预期。

在实际应用中,实体类型变量的Symfony断言可以用于各种场景,例如:

  1. 在表单处理中,验证用户提交的实体对象是否符合预期的类型。
  2. 在控制器中,验证从数据库中获取的实体对象是否正确。
  3. 在服务层中,验证传递给方法的实体对象是否满足要求。

对于实体类型变量的Symfony断言,腾讯云并没有提供专门的产品或链接地址。然而,腾讯云提供了丰富的云计算服务和解决方案,可以帮助开发人员构建和部署基于云计算的应用程序。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

14分12秒

050.go接口的类型断言

18分26秒

golang教程 go语言基础 73 面向对象:接口的类型断言 学习猿地

7分56秒

31_尚硅谷_SpringMVC_通过实体类型的形参获取请求参数

10分41秒

011_尚硅谷_爬虫_查看变量的数据类型

4分52秒

023_尚硅谷_Scala_变量和数据类型(十一)_Unit类型的源码实现

2分55秒

46.默认情况下载通用Mapper忽略实体类中的复杂类型.avi

6分19秒

02-javascript/04-尚硅谷-JavaScript-JavaScript的变量和数据类型介绍

14分8秒

day02_Java基本语法/19-尚硅谷-Java语言基础-String类型变量的使用

14分8秒

day02_Java基本语法/19-尚硅谷-Java语言基础-String类型变量的使用

14分8秒

day02_Java基本语法/19-尚硅谷-Java语言基础-String类型变量的使用

9分54秒

057.errors.As函数

2分32秒

052.go的类型转换总结

领券